你查询的IP:[202.104.176.1]  地理位置:中国–广东–东莞

最新查询60.200.78.38 59.191.253.99 60.247.184.17 218.56.17.85 120.8.17.126 119.96.157.240 124.66.51.51 203.92.91.211 121.219.16.72 202.104.176.1 219.242.29.8 219.128.55.167 166.111.57.21 58.100.109.80 220.231.182.84 117.53.176.183 124.47.177.74 119.144.65.192 120.92.190.191 114.68.204.255 59.191.28.57 123.144.221.208 221.95.101.255 120.52.203.9 122.156.222.253 221.136.37.72 116.192.162.76 123.242.96.200 203.91.120.48 121.52.224.205 221.12.128.11